Action-Adventure Gameplay: Unlike standard Mortal Kombat titles, you explore the Outworld, solve puzzles, and fight waves of enemies.

Iconic Characters: Play as Liu Kang or Kung Lao in story mode. Unlockable Secrets: Sub-Zero: Complete the game with Kung Lao. Scorpion: Complete the game with Liu Kang.

Mortal Kombat II Arcade: Complete all 5 Smoke Missions to unlock the full classic arcade game.

Brutal Fatalities: Every character retains their signature finishers, such as Kung Lao's infamous "Body Slice". How to Play on PC and Android

Ko-op Mode: Unlike many titles of its era, the game was built for two players. Certain areas and secrets are only accessible when playing with a partner.

Multi-Directional Combat: A fluid combat system allows you to attack enemies surrounding you from all sides.

Upgradable Moves: Use experience points earned from battles to upgrade signature special moves like Liu Kang's Bicycle Kick or Kung Lao's Hat Toss.

On-the-Fly Fatalities: Once your fatality meter is full, you can perform iconic finishers to clear obstacles or decimate bosses. How to Play on Android & PC

While searching for a "highly compressed" version of the game, keep the following safety and technical factors in mind: No "Magic" Compression

: A game cannot be played while it is compressed to a fraction of its size. Once you extract a highly compressed

file, it will expand back to its original size (several gigabytes) on your hard drive. Avoid Executable Files ( : Legitimate game backups will extract into formats like . If a site asks you to download and run an file to "extract" or play the game, do not open it , as this is a common method for spreading malware. Potential for Cut Content

: Some extreme compression methods used by third-party uploaders achieve tiny file sizes by stripping out game assets. Be careful not to download "ripped" versions that have removed the background music, cutscenes, or voice acting. 🚀 How to Play the Game Safely
